About Dr. Michael Gilels, MD

Dr. Michael Gilels, MD is a dedicated Internal Medicine physician practicing in Stuart, FL. He is committed to providing high-quality, comprehensive, and patient-centered care to adults. Registered with the Florida Board of Medicine and practicing under Florida Statutes, Title XXXII, Chapter 458 (Medical Practice), Dr. Gilels's practice is focused on addressing a wide range of adult health concerns. He is not currently accepting new patients, but you can call (772) 200-4205 to inquire about waitlists or future openings.

Dr. Michael Gilels, MD is an internist in Stuart, FL, with over 40 years of experience in the medical field. He earned his medical degree from State University Of New York Upstate Medical University Norton College Of Medicine in 1981, followed by an internship and residency in Internal Medicine at Shands Teach Hospital|University Of Florida Shands Teaching Hospital Gainesville, Fl from 1981-1984. His experience encompasses a deep understanding of the comprehensive medical care of adults, and he is Board Certified in Internal Medicine by the American Board of Internal Medicine. He is affiliated with Cleveland Clinic Martin North Hospital and Cleveland Clinic Martin South Hospital. Dr. Gilels's care philosophy centers on partnership with his patients, helping them prevent, diagnose, treat, and manage their healthcare needs throughout the process. He prioritizes building relationships and providing personalized attention to each patient, guiding them towards optimal health and well-being. He provides consultations primarily in English.

      Internal Medicine Conditions Addressed

      Dr. Michael Gilels addresses a wide range of Internal Medicine health concerns, including:

      • Polyneuropathy: Polyneuropathy is a condition that affects many nerves throughout the body, causing symptoms like pain, numbness, and weakness.
      • Arthritis: Arthritis refers to joint pain and stiffness, often accompanied by swelling and reduced mobility.
      • Osteoarthritis of Hand: Osteoarthritis of the hand causes pain, stiffness, and swelling in the hand joints.
      • Mineral Metabolism Disorders: Mineral metabolism disorders affect the processes that regulate mineral levels, potentially causing bone problems, muscle weakness, or other symptoms.
      • Dysphagia: Dysphagia is a symptom characterized by discomfort or difficulty in swallowing.
      • Pollen Allergy: Pollen allergy causes symptoms like sneezing, runny nose, and itchy eyes.
      • Urinary Incontinence: Urinary incontinence is a condition where you involuntarily leak urine.
      • Muscle Cramping: Involuntary muscle contractions leading to pain and stiffness are commonly known as muscle cramps.
      • Diabetes Type 1: Type 1 diabetes requires daily insulin injections or the use of an insulin pump to manage blood sugar and prevent complications.
      • Diarrhea: Diarrhea is characterized by loose, watery stools occurring more frequently than usual.
      • Dermatitis Due to Drugs: Some medications can cause skin reactions, like rashes or itching.
      • Leukocytopenia: Leukocytopenia is a condition characterized by a deficiency of white blood cells in your blood.

      Internal Medicine Services Provided

      Dr. Michael Gilels offers a range of services to support your Adult patient's health and well-being, such as:

      • Arterial Blood Gas Test (ABG): An arterial blood gas test is a quick procedure that checks the oxygen and carbon dioxide in your artery blood and determines if your blood is too acidic or alkaline.
      • Electrocardiogram (EKG): An EKG uses small sensors to monitor your heart's electrical signals and create a visual record.
      • Immunization Administration: This refers to receiving a vaccine to protect against infectious diseases.
      • Hepatitis C Treatment: Hepatitis C treatment involves medication to eliminate the virus from your body.
      • Worker's Compensation Evaluations: During this visit, we'll document your injuries or illness, assess your functional limitations, and determine the extent of your disability related to your job.
      • CT Scan (Computed Tomography): A CT scan uses X-rays to create detailed pictures of the inside of your body.
      • Polypharmacy: Taking five or more medications regularly is often considered polypharmacy and may increase health risks.

      What is Internal Medicine?
      Internal medicine is a medical specialty focused on the prevention, diagnosis, and treatment of adult diseases. We provide comprehensive care, encompassing a wide range of conditions and focusing on overall health management. While similar to family medicine, internal medicine specifically addresses the health needs of adults.
